About E. Hála

E. Hála is a scholar working on Organic Chemistry, Biomedical Engineering, Fluid Flow and Transfer Processes, Filtration and Separation and Control and Systems Engineering, having authored 28 papers that have together received 526 indexed citations. Recurring topics across this work include Chemical Thermodynamics and Molecular Structure (10 papers), Phase Equilibria and Thermodynamics (8 papers), Thermodynamic properties of mixtures (6 papers), Chemical and Physical Properties in Aqueous Solutions (5 papers), Process Optimization and Integration (3 papers), Adsorption, diffusion, and thermodynamic properties of materials (2 papers), Field-Flow Fractionation Techniques (2 papers) and Inorganic and Organometallic Chemistry (1 paper). The work is most often cited by research in Filtration and Separation (92 citations), Fluid Flow and Transfer Processes (241 citations), Organic Chemistry (212 citations), Biomedical Engineering (288 citations) and Catalysis (37 citations). E. Hála has collaborated with scholars based in Czechia, United States and Belgium. Frequent co-authors include V. Fried, T. Boublík, Tomáš Boublı́k, I. Wichterle, J. Linek, J. Pick, John M. Prausnitz, Aage Fredenslund, Vojtěch Bekárek and Warren E. Stewart. Their work appears in journals such as Fluid Phase Equilibria, AIChE Journal, Industrial & Engineering Chemistry Fundamentals, Industrial & Engineering Chemistry Process Design and Development and Medical Entomology and Zoology.
